When Rishabh Pant, the Lucknow Super Giants (LSG) captain, won the toss and invited the Punjab Kings to bat during the Indian Premier League (IPL) 2026 clash at the Maharaja Yadavindra Sigh International Stadium in Mullanpur, he perhaps had no idea of what was going to come. 

Both the left-handed aggressive batters of the home side, Priyansh Arya and Cooper Connolly, nailed the visiting bowlers around the park. The bowler, for a moment, seemed to have only the job of delivering the ball and looking into the sky to see the ball sailing out of the park.

Priyansh Arya smacks Mohin Khan for huge six in IPL 2026

The left-arm pacer, Mohsin Khan, didn’t enjoy a great evening against the Punjab batters. The last ball of his fourth over was a short one at Priyansh, who picked the length so early, went back and got under the ball to use his wrist and pulled it over the square leg for a massive six. 

On the third ball of the last over inside the powerplay, Mohsin nearly had the best of the batter, who dragged it off the inside edge as it rolled through the backward square leg for a boundary. The very next delivery was sent into the stands over the long leg for another six.

Arya finished the over with another six. This time, he used his full power and nailed the pull for a six as the Kings raced away to 63/1 in their six overs. They put up a partnership of 182 runs off just 80 balls as the Delhi-born got dismissed for 93 runs in 37 balls at a strike rate of 251.35, with the help of nine sixes and four boundaries.

PBKS post 254/7 with clean hitting and flurry of boundaries

Apart from Arya, Connolly also contributed a strong knock of 87 runs in just 46 balls at a strike rate of 189.13 with the help of eight boundaries and seven sixes. Marcus Stoinis clubbed 29 runs off 16 balls as the PBKS side posted the massive score of 254/7 in their allotted 20 overs, which became the highest team score of the IPL 2026.

Meanwhile, Prince Yadav was the most impressive bowler for his figures of 2/25 in four overs at an economy rate of 6.20. That means that the rest of the bowling unit went for 229 runs in just 16 overs.

Brief Scores (at the time of writing): LSG 12/0 (Mitchell Marsh 9*) vs PBKS 254/7 (Priyansh Arya 93, Cooper Connolly 87, Prince Yadav 2/25)
